Overall Review of Crystal Place
Pros
The selection is incredible and meticulously sorted.
The store boasts a great selection of crystals, art pieces, and jewelry.
The store owner is amazing and passionate, and she has happily allowed customers to stay late.
Her passion clearly shows in the store itself.
The place is an experience—beautifully curated with a huge selection of crystals, bones, and art, and it feels whimsical, elegant, cottagecore, and inviting.
The shop is adorable and well worth a visit.
The shop offers a diverse range of items, including jewelry, carved animals, cartoon-character pieces, palm stones, and polished stones, with pieces like Labradorite, Amethyst, Chariote, Malachite, Calcite, and Onyx.
